Transaction 596233087b02951ccaba01d0d2598b12839e0bfce36890b088d0087f8f9c6309
1 Input
1 Output
-
596233087b02951ccaba01d0d2598b12839e0bfce36890b088d0087f8f9c6309:0
- value
- 10690911
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 917c24c4e6080c341a7741de351a65e8e2965661 OP_EQUAL
- address
- 3ExGd1X55MAangbwmo16nR5vXrgQ8VHaWF